Output 28c2be9520848a453af9f9719341b7e11019f33d38370f0e52916816b708788a:3

value
6095821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ac62eaac66d756087c6e386ff1876e5a50af13fc OP_EQUAL
address
3HQWePdHoE5G9XQuqzy84CbPXt4WFC7BVe
transaction
28c2be9520848a453af9f9719341b7e11019f33d38370f0e52916816b708788a
confirmations
299179
spent
true